Skip to content

Commit 398d520

Browse files
authored
Update jsonTree.au3
1 parent a83dab3 commit 398d520

1 file changed

Lines changed: 5 additions & 8 deletions

File tree

examples/v1.4.2_jsonTree/jsonTree.au3

Lines changed: 5 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,3 @@
1-
#Region ; *** Dynamically added Include files ***
2-
#include <IE.au3> ; added:01/18/26 22:09:02
3-
#EndRegion ; *** Dynamically added Include files ***
41
;~ #AutoIt3Wrapper_UseX64=y
52
#AutoIt3Wrapper_UseX64=n
63
#AutoIt3Wrapper_Run_AU3Check=Y
@@ -21,6 +18,7 @@ _Example()
2118
Func _Example()
2219
Local $oMyError = ObjEvent("AutoIt.Error", __NetWebView2_COMErrFunc)
2320
#forceref $oMyError
21+
2422
; Create GUI with resizing support
2523
Local $hGUI = GUICreate("WebView2AutoIt JSON Viewer", 500, 650, -1, -1, BitOR($WS_OVERLAPPEDWINDOW, $WS_CLIPCHILDREN))
2624
GUISetBkColor(0x2B2B2B, $hGUI)
@@ -51,9 +49,11 @@ Func _Example()
5149
$_g_oWeb = $oWebV2M
5250
If @error Then Return SetError(@error, @extended, $oWebV2M)
5351

54-
; Important: Pass $hGUI in parentheses to maintain Pointer type for COM
55-
Local $sProfileDirectory = @TempDir & "\NetWebView2Lib-UserDataFolder"
52+
; Initialize JavaScript Bridge
53+
Local $oJSBridge = _NetWebView2_GetBridge($oWebV2M)
54+
If @error Then Return SetError(@error, @extended, $oWebV2M)
5655

56+
Local $sProfileDirectory = @TempDir & "\NetWebView2Lib-UserDataFolder"
5757
_NetWebView2_Initialize($oWebV2M, $hGUI, $sProfileDirectory, 0, 50, 0, 0, True, True, True, 1.2, "0x2B2B2B")
5858

5959
; Initial JSON display
@@ -65,9 +65,6 @@ Func _Example()
6565

6666
Local $sLastSearch = ""
6767

68-
; Initialize JavaScript Bridge
69-
Local $oJSBridge = _NetWebView2_GetBridge($oWebV2M)
70-
7168
; Main Application Loop
7269
While 1
7370
Switch GUIGetMsg()

0 commit comments

Comments
 (0)